There is something so profound in watching how potters make their masterpieces… how each piece is deliberately formed and created. As the clay-work of God’s hands, we often stay discouraged when Our Potter is working in us because we only see the mess instead of the masterpiece. This session introduces the theme of the Wednesday workshops and reminds us to trust the Potter’s process as He makes something beautiful in His time.
